    The second coin is a 2 Reichsmark from Germany, 1937, but I can't make out the mintmark, it is located on the "heads" side of the coin on the left side... No mintmark is rare per se, but the G has the lowest mintage. They range in value of 2.50 in Fine to 12.00 in UNC according to the 2nd edition of catalog of German coins. Which is hopelessly outdated BTW.

    The last coin is a 1910-F Wurretemberg 3 mark which looks pretty nice... Mintage of 837 thousand and valued at 30.00 in XF and 50.00 in UNC. Again from the old outdated Krause German catalog...
